public void setParameters() {
            CSConnect.cConnect connect = new CSConnect.cConnect();
            cParameter param = null;

			for (int _i = 0; _i < m_report.getConnect().getParameters().count(); _i++) {
				param = m_report.getConnect().getParameters().item(_i);
				CSConnect.cParameter connectParam = connect.getParameters().add();
				connectParam.setName(param.getName());
					connectParam.setValue(param.getValue());
            }

			if (m_report.getConnect().getDataSource() == "") {
                cWindow.msgWarning("Before editting the parameter info you must define a connection");
                return;
            }

			connect.setStrConnect(m_report.getConnect().getStrConnect());
			connect.setDataSource(m_report.getConnect().getDataSource());
			connect.setDataSourceType(m_report.getConnect().getDataSourceType());

			if (!connect.getDataSourceColumnsInfo(m_report.getConnect().getDataSource(), 
				m_report.getConnect().getDataSourceType())) 
            	return;

			cGlobals.setParametersAux(connect, m_report.getConnect());
        }